1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Lightly coat a 9x13-inch casserole dish with baking spray and set aside.
2. Cook and shred chicken, following these easy steps*.
3. To make the enchiladas: Heat the oil in a large skillet or sauté pan on medium heat. Once oil the is warm, add the peppers and onion.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ables soften and the onions become translucent, about 8 to 10 minutes.
4. To the skillet, add the shredded chicken, 1/2 teaspoon salt, chili powder, garlic powder, cumin, and black pepper. Stir to coat evenly, then remove the skillet from the heat and let cool.
